将Geany链接到Python上非常简单,主要步骤包括安装Geany、配置Python解释器、设置编译和运行命令等。安装Geany、配置Python解释器、设置编译命令、设置运行命令、测试配置。下面将详细介绍如何完成这些步骤:
一、安装GEANY
首先,你需要在你的计算机上安装Geany。Geany是一个轻量级的跨平台集成开发环境(IDE),支持多种编程语言,包括Python。
-
下载和安装Geany
- 访问Geany的官方网站(https://www.geany.org/)。
- 下载适用于你操作系统的安装包。
- 按照安装向导完成安装过程。
-
安装Python
- 访问Python的官方网站(https://www.python.org/)。
- 下载适用于你操作系统的Python安装包。
- 按照安装向导完成安装过程,注意勾选“Add Python to PATH”选项。
二、配置PYTHON解释器
在Geany中配置Python解释器,以便Geany能够识别和使用Python进行编程和调试。
-
启动Geany
- 打开Geany应用程序,你将看到一个简单直观的用户界面。
-
配置Python解释器
- 进入Geany,点击菜单栏上的“Build”选项,然后选择“Set Build Commands”。
- 在出现的对话框中,你将看到“Compile”命令和“Execute”命令。
- 在“Execute”命令框中输入:
python "%f"
,这意味着Geany将使用Python解释器来运行当前打开的Python文件。
三、设置编译命令
虽然Python是解释型语言,不需要编译,但你仍然可以配置Geany以便于其他语言的编译。
-
进入Build Commands
- 再次进入Geany的“Build”菜单,选择“Set Build Commands”。
-
配置编译命令
- 在“Compile”命令框中可以输入:
python -m py_compile "%f"
,这条命令将编译Python文件并检查语法错误。
- 在“Compile”命令框中可以输入:
四、设置运行命令
配置运行命令,以便可以直接在Geany中运行Python脚本。
-
进入Build Commands
- 进入“Build”菜单,选择“Set Build Commands”。
-
配置运行命令
- 在“Execute”命令框中输入:
python "%f"
。这条命令将运行当前打开的Python文件。
- 在“Execute”命令框中输入:
五、测试配置
最后,通过一个简单的Python脚本来测试你的Geany与Python的配置是否成功。
-
创建新文件
- 在Geany中,点击“File”菜单,选择“New”来创建一个新的文件。
-
编写简单的Python代码
print("Hello, World!")
- 将上述代码粘贴到新文件中。
-
保存文件
- 保存文件,确保文件扩展名为
.py
。
- 保存文件,确保文件扩展名为
-
运行Python脚本
- 点击“Build”菜单,选择“Execute”或者按F5键。你应该能够在Geany的输出窗口中看到“Hello, World!”的打印结果。
通过上述步骤,你已经成功将Geany链接到Python上。接下来我们将进一步探讨每个步骤的详细内容及其背后的原理。
一、安装GEANY
Geany是一款轻量级的IDE,支持多种编程语言,特别适合初学者和轻度开发者。安装Geany非常简单,你只需要访问Geany官网,下载适用于你操作系统的安装包,然后按照安装向导进行安装。
1.1 下载和安装Geany
访问Geany的官方网站(https://www.geany.org/),在下载页面中选择适用于你操作系统的安装包。Geany支持Windows、macOS、Linux等多个操作系统。下载完成后,双击安装包,按照安装向导进行安装。
1.2 安装Python
Python是一种解释型的高级编程语言,广泛应用于Web开发、数据分析、人工智能等领域。要在Geany中开发Python应用,你需要先安装Python解释器。访问Python的官方网站(https://www.python.org/),在下载页面中选择适用于你操作系统的安装包,下载并安装。在安装过程中,务必勾选“Add Python to PATH”选项,以便在命令行中直接使用python
命令。
二、配置PYTHON解释器
在Geany中配置Python解释器,使其能够识别和使用Python进行编程和调试。
2.1 启动Geany
打开Geany应用程序,你将看到一个简洁的用户界面。Geany的设计理念是简洁易用,适合快速编写和调试代码。
2.2 配置Python解释器
进入Geany,点击菜单栏上的“Build”选项,然后选择“Set Build Commands”。在出现的对话框中,你将看到“Compile”命令和“Execute”命令。在“Execute”命令框中输入:python "%f"
,这意味着Geany将使用Python解释器来运行当前打开的Python文件。
三、设置编译命令
虽然Python是解释型语言,不需要编译,但你仍然可以配置Geany以便于其他语言的编译。
3.1 进入Build Commands
再次进入Geany的“Build”菜单,选择“Set Build Commands”。
3.2 配置编译命令
在“Compile”命令框中可以输入:python -m py_compile "%f"
,这条命令将编译Python文件并检查语法错误。尽管Python不需要编译,这个步骤可以帮助你检查代码中的语法错误。
四、设置运行命令
配置运行命令,以便可以直接在Geany中运行Python脚本。
4.1 进入Build Commands
进入“Build”菜单,选择“Set Build Commands”。
4.2 配置运行命令
在“Execute”命令框中输入:python "%f"
。这条命令将运行当前打开的Python文件。
五、测试配置
通过一个简单的Python脚本来测试你的Geany与Python的配置是否成功。
5.1 创建新文件
在Geany中,点击“File”菜单,选择“New”来创建一个新的文件。
5.2 编写简单的Python代码
print("Hello, World!")
将上述代码粘贴到新文件中。
5.3 保存文件
保存文件,确保文件扩展名为.py
。这是Python文件的标准扩展名。
5.4 运行Python脚本
点击“Build”菜单,选择“Execute”或者按F5键。你应该能够在Geany的输出窗口中看到“Hello, World!”的打印结果。
六、深入理解Geany与Python的集成
了解Geany与Python集成的背后原理,有助于你更好地使用和配置Geany。
6.1 Geany的插件系统
Geany拥有强大的插件系统,可以扩展其功能。例如,你可以安装GeanyPy插件,以便在Geany中更方便地进行Python开发。
6.2 自定义构建命令
Geany允许用户自定义构建命令,这使得你可以根据需要调整编译和运行命令。例如,你可以添加对其他Python工具(如pytest、flake8)的支持,以增强开发体验。
6.3 代码自动补全与语法高亮
Geany支持代码自动补全和语法高亮,这对提高编码效率非常有帮助。你可以在“编辑”菜单下找到相关设置,并进行调整。
七、常见问题及解决方案
在使用Geany进行Python开发时,你可能会遇到一些常见问题。以下是一些常见问题及其解决方案。
7.1 Geany无法识别Python解释器
确保Python已正确安装,并且安装时勾选了“Add Python to PATH”选项。你可以在命令行中输入python --version
检查Python是否安装成功。
7.2 无法运行Python脚本
检查“Execute”命令是否正确配置为python "%f"
。确保当前文件已保存,并且扩展名为.py
。
7.3 语法错误和调试
使用python -m py_compile "%f"
命令检查语法错误。对于更复杂的调试需求,你可以使用Python的内置调试器(pdb)或其他调试工具。
八、提升Geany使用体验的技巧
一些小技巧可以帮助你更高效地使用Geany进行Python开发。
8.1 自定义快捷键
你可以在Geany的“编辑”菜单下找到“首选项”,然后自定义快捷键。常用的快捷键如运行(F5)、保存(Ctrl+S)等,可以根据个人习惯进行调整。
8.2 使用模板
Geany支持代码模板,可以帮助你快速生成常用的代码结构。你可以在“文件”菜单下找到“新建自模板”选项,选择合适的模板进行快速开发。
8.3 集成版本控制
Geany支持与版本控制系统(如Git)集成。你可以安装相关插件,以便在Geany中直接进行版本控制操作,方便团队协作和代码管理。
九、总结
通过以上步骤和技巧,你可以轻松地将Geany链接到Python上,并在Geany中高效地进行Python开发。Geany作为一款轻量级的IDE,具有简洁易用、功能强大的特点,非常适合Python开发。希望本文对你有所帮助,祝你在Geany中编程愉快!
相关问答FAQs:
如何在Geany中设置Python环境?
在Geany中设置Python环境非常简单。首先,确保您的计算机上已安装Python。接下来,打开Geany,选择“编辑”菜单中的“首选项”,在“构建”选项卡中找到“命令”部分。在这里,您可以将“编译器”设置为Python解释器的路径,通常是python3
或python
,然后保存设置。这样,您就可以直接在Geany中运行Python代码了。
Geany支持哪些Python版本?
Geany支持多种Python版本,包括Python 2和Python 3。建议使用Python 3,因为它是当前主流的版本,并且许多现代库和框架已经不再支持Python 2。您可以在Geany的设置中选择使用的Python版本,以确保与您的项目兼容。
如何在Geany中调试Python代码?
在Geany中调试Python代码需要一些额外的设置。您可以使用gdb
作为调试器。首先,确保在Geany的“构建”选项卡中配置了调试器路径。然后,通过在代码中添加断点,您可以逐步执行代码并观察变量值的变化。这为发现和修复bug提供了便利。